程序员.NET_程序员俱乐部_.NET频道

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 > 编程开发 > .NET > 文章列表
· 【单例模式】Singleton pattern发布时间:2014-07-31
前言:有很多时候,在一个生命周期中我们只要一个对象就可以了,比如:线程池,缓存,对话框,日志,显卡驱动等等。如果造出多个实例,就会导致许多问题产生,例如:程序的行为异常、资源使用过量,或者说不一致的结果。publicclassSingleton{pr... 查看全文
· SunSonic 3.0 ORM开源框架的学习发布时间:2014-07-31
SubSonic3.0简介接触到SubSonic3.0ORM框架是看了AllEmpty大神的从零开始编写自己的C#框架(链接在此)系列的随笔接触到的,本文章学习内容源于AllEmpty大神。SubSonic就是一个ORM开源框架。作者是RobeCon... 查看全文
自我感觉封装得还不错!!!代码如下:C#代码#region上传文件的方法///<summary>///上传文件方法///</summary>///<paramname="myFileUpload">上传控件ID&l... 查看全文
· 1. Server.Transfer跳转页面抛出异发布时间:2014-07-31
今天在向数据库插入数据,之后使用Server.Transfer跳回本页面时,抛出异常:正在终止线程ry{if(0==String.Compare(Password.Text.Trim(),ConfirmPassword.Text.Trim()))//... 查看全文
· 【C#】CLR内存那点事(初级)发布时间:2014-07-31
最近回头看了一下书,对内存的理解又有新的认识。我所关注的内存里面说没有寄存器的,所以我关注的只有托管堆(heap),栈(stack),字符串常量池(string是一个很特殊的对象)首先我们看两个方法:voidM1(){stringname="Tom"... 查看全文
· 1. Server.Transfer和Respon发布时间:2014-07-31
今天在使用ServerTransfer和Response.Redirect定位到当前页面来实现刷新页面时,发现了一些现象:1.使用Response.Redirect刷新本页面,造成当前页面显示的数据消失的情况:protectedvoidPage_Lo... 查看全文
· 【转载】HTTP 错误 500.19发布时间:2014-07-31
windows2008下IIS7安装ASP.NET遇到如下错误:HTTP错误500.19-InternalServerError无法访问请求的页面,因为该页的相关配置数据无效。详细错误信息模块IISWebCore通知BeginRequest处理程序尚... 查看全文
· Code First, Database Firs发布时间:2014-07-31
CodeFirst,DatabaseFirst,SameTime是我理解的asp.netmvc中用到的三种model与数据库对应的方式,肯定是不全面的,理解也有些狭隘,今后随着自己的理解加深再来修改这篇帖子吧。这三种方式在格斗人网(www.helpq... 查看全文
· set{变量 = value;}get{retur发布时间:2014-07-31
形如:publicstring_customValue{set{_customValue=value;}get{return_customValue;}}这是属性,用于封装字段的,一般类中的字段都是private,不允许外部直接访问,必须通过属性来访... 查看全文
· 窗体与子线程的交互发布时间:2014-07-31
窗体与子线程间通讯方法窗体上的UI默认情况下不允许使用子线程(或者其它非创建控件的UI线程)去控制(这在NET2.0以下是允许的,但是考虑到安全性等问题,从2.0开始就禁止使用这个功能,除非Form的CheckForIllegalCrossThrea... 查看全文
· 在项目中使用JMail发送邮件发布时间:2014-07-31
1.添加JMail组件:在vs的解决方案资源管理器中,右键添加引用,选择浏览,选择jmail.dll文件,在Bin文件夹中就可以看到添加的JMail组件.2.注册JMail组件:开始-->运行-->输入如:regsvr32D:\DotNe... 查看全文
· 如何得到Sessionid的值发布时间:2014-07-31
当用户向一个网站请求第一个页面时,用户会话启动。当第一个页面被请求时,web服务器将asp.net_sessionIDcookie添加进用户的浏览器。可以使用newsession属性探测新会话的启动。当新会话启动时,newsession属性返回tru... 查看全文
· 【学习】is 和 as发布时间:2014-07-31
看个例子:publicclassUser{}publicclassGroup{}classProgram{staticvoidMain(string[]args){ObjectoUser=newUser();Objectuser=(Group)oUs... 查看全文
一.扩展名:.aspx:窗体文件,为前台程序。.cs文件:类文件,主要为后台数据处理,供所有的.aspx文件的后台应用。.asmx文件:用于创建从其他应用程序使用的web服务的类。.css文件:样式表单,设置界面的整体风格。二.特殊文件夹:App_B... 查看全文
· page.ClientScript.Registe发布时间:2014-07-31
page.ClientScript.RegisterStartupScript()可以添加客户端脚本,有4个参数type:要注册的启动脚本的类型。key:要注册的启动脚本的键。script:要注册的启动脚本文本。addScriptTags:指示是否添... 查看全文
· 一个ORM的实现(附源代码)发布时间:2014-07-31
1前言经过一段时间的编写,终于有出来一个稳定的版本,期间考虑了多种解决方案也偷偷学了下园子里面大神们的作品。已经有很多的ORM框架,为什么要自己实现一个?我的原因是在遇到特殊需求时,可以在ORM中加入特定的代码。如:根据数据库的字段长度和可空性做基本... 查看全文
· 面向.Net程序员的dump分析发布时间:2014-07-31
背景Dump文件是进程的内存镜像。可以把程序的执行状态通过调试器保存到dump文件中。在Windows系统上,dump文件分为内核dump和用户态dump两种。前者一般用来分析内核相关的问题,比如驱动程序;后者一般用来分析用户态程序的问题。一般的程序... 查看全文
WPF中引用资源分为静态引用与动态引用,两者的区别在哪里呢?我们通过一个小的例子来理解。点击“Update”按钮,第2个按钮的文字会变成“更上一层楼”,而第1个按钮的文字没有变化。原因是第1个按钮文字用... 查看全文
· ASP.NET MVC + EF 利用存储过程读取发布时间:2014-07-30
看到本文的标题,相信你会忍不住进来看看!没错,本文要讲的就是这个重量级的东西,这个不仅仅支持单表查询,更能支持连接查询,加入一个表10W数据,另一个表也是10万数据,当你用linq建立一个连接查询然后利用take,skip读取第N页数据的时候,你的程... 查看全文
· 在ASP.NET中过滤HTML字符串总结发布时间:2014-07-30
先记下来,以作备用!C#代码///<summary>去除HTML标记//////</summary>///<paramname="Htmlstring">包括HTML的源码</param>///<... 查看全文